If the transformer gets hot with all the tubes pulled, it's shorted. Most likely primary or HV secondary would have some shorted turns.

The 84 is the most likely culprit if the transformer is OK - they are prone to shorting, and it's probably the reason the transformer was previously replaced. A fuse is a REALLY good idea.
